The Era of Power Scarcity

Honeywell Process Solutions’ ‘The Era of Power Scarcity’ white paper presents a sobering analysis of the global energy landscape, where electricity demand is accelerating beyond the capacity of existing grids. For the first time in nearly 75 years, energy consumption –driven by industrialisation, electrification, and the exponential growth of data centres – is outpacing supply. By 2050, data centres alone could consume up to 9% of global electricity.

This imbalance is compounded by ageing infrastructure, climate volatility, and the rapid shift to intermittent renewable energy sources like solar and wind. While renewables are essential for decarbonisation, their variability introduces new risks to grid stability. The result is a fragile energy system increasingly prone to brownouts, blackouts, and costly disruptions.

Energy scarcity is rapidly emerging as a critical threat to economic growth and public safety. Without strategic intervention, the US Department of Energy estimates that outages and downtime could cost American businesses over US$1.5 trillion this decade.

This white paper emphasises that a practical path forward begins at the edge of the grid - with modular microgrids, distributed energy systems, and integrated climate services. These technologies offer immediate resilience, faster returns, and a scalable foundation for decarbonisation. They also enable dynamic responses to environmental conditions, energy pricing, and demand fluctuations.

Ultimately, the paper calls for a reimagining of energy infrastructure – one that balances sustainability with reliability, and innovation with urgency.
